Trouvez ici les démarches courantes à faire en cas d'écran noir.
Répondre

Blocage avec le noyau 6_6.24-1

#1Messageil y a 1 mois

Bonjour à tous
Suite à la mise à jour de mon PC avec notamment le noyau 6 quelque chose, j'ai eu un blocage au démarrage de mon PC sur l'écran noir avec le nom da ma carte mère (ASUS) et, dans la partie basse l’icône et le nom de Manjaro.

Devant mon impossibilité de pouvoir choisir dans l'écran du GRUB sur mon ancienne installation et l'impossibilité d’utiliser le chroot (je prépare un nouveau sujet la dessus), je me suis résolu à ré-installer Manjaro KDE. Heureusement, mon home est séparé ce qui simplifie beaucoup de chose.

Première constatation, Youtube refonctionne normalement sous firefox (avec mon ancienne installation j'avais un message d'erreur avec l'impossibilité de charger la vidéo, message disparaissant avec la suppression de Ubloc Origin).
Je réinstalle mes programmes favoris et, là, encore, impossibilité d'installer mon imprimante et quelques autres programmes. Et pour cause, Make n'est pas installé par défaut, je me fais avoir avoir à chaque fois :?

Bref, après mise à jour, je relance ma machine et là, horreur, ça bloque de nouveau ;rale:;rale:
Je recommence en essayant de faire apparaître le menu de GRUB. La encore pas de succès sauf après plusieurs tentative en essayant la touche "e" et "ESC". Je ne sais toujours pas laquelle à fonctionner mais, ouf, j'y arrive.
Je m'aperçois que je démarre avec la version 6_6.24-1, en sélectionnant la version 5_5 tout refonctionne.

Pour le Grub, les recherches sur Internet ne sont pas très pertinente sur sa configuration. Cependant, j'ai trouvé sur le site d'Ubuntu un chapitre assez complet. Je verrais si j'arrive à mes fins.

Quanq à la version 6 du noyau.....je vais attendre

Blocage avec le noyau 6_6.24-1

#2Messageil y a 1 mois

Ce matin, nous sommes avec le 6.6.25-1
et là, horreur, ça bloque de nouveau
Ce qui est plutôt normal non ? Si une version ne fonctionne pas, après re-install, il est logique qu'elle ne fonctionne toujours pas puisque nous avons toujours le même matériel :wink:
Note: ne pas oublier que le downgrade existe

Blocage avec le noyau 6_6.24-1

#3Messageil y a 1 mois

bonjour

peux tu nous fournir

sudo mhwd-kernel -li
sudo mhwd -li
sudo cat /etc/mkinitcpio.conf
Dernière modification par stephaneil y a 1 mois, modifié au total 1 fois.

Blocage avec le noyau 6_6.24-1

#4Messageil y a 1 mois

Bonjour et merci de la réponse

Pour stephane

sudo mhwd-kernel -li                                                                           ✔ 
sudo mhwd -li
sudo cat /ect/mkinitcpio.conf

[sudo] Mot de passe de pc-pym : 
Currently running: 6.5.5-1-MANJARO (linux65)
The following kernels are installed in your system:
   * linux65
   * linux66
> Installed PCI configs:
--------------------------------------------------------------------------------
                  NAME               VERSION          FREEDRIVER           TYPE
--------------------------------------------------------------------------------
           video-linux            2018.05.04                true            PCI


Warning: No installed USB configs!
cat: /ect/mkinitcpio.conf: Aucun fichier ou dossier de ce nom
Ce warning me laisse perplexe, d'autant plus que mon USB fonctionne bien. Un petit tour sur le net m'apporte des réponses en Anglais ce qui me rend encore plus perplexe.

Papajoke me dît que le downgrade existe mais comment faire quand tout est bloqué avant même que Manjaro charge ???

Blocage avec le noyau 6_6.24-1

#5Messageil y a 1 mois

bonjour :
alors linux6.5 est EOL , il est à retirer
il faut ajouter le noyau 6.8.x ( x >= 3)

sudo mhwd-kernel -i linux68
il faut afficher le menu grub par défaut
GRUB_TIMEOUT_STYLE=menu

sudo nano /etc/default/grub
sudo update-grub
et sélectionner en avancée le noyau
pour ton architecture , les noyaux 6.6 , 6.7 et 6.8 sont supportés , pour la version 6.7 il passe en EOL

pour la dernière commande

sudo cat /etc/mkinitcpio.conf

Blocage avec le noyau 6_6.24-1

#6Messageil y a 1 mois

Un grand merci Stephane

pour le grub, le GRUB_TIMEOUT_STYLE était bien celui à modifier. Les recherches sur Internet c'est bien, mais beaucoup d'infos parfois contradictoire ou complètement en retard.

Si sudo mhwd-kernel -i linux68 et sudo update-grub sont compréhensible, je ne comprends pas pourquoi la commande sudo cat /etc/mkinitcpio.conf, uniquement pour afficher le fichier de configuration ?

Encore merci

Blocage avec le noyau 6_6.24-1

#7Messageil y a 1 mois

pymlinux a écrit : il y a 1 mois Si sudo mhwd-kernel -i linux68 et sudo update-grub sont compréhensible, je ne comprends pas pourquoi la commande sudo cat /etc/mkinitcpio.conf, uniquement pour afficher le fichier de configuration ?
Bonjour.
Il faut être prudent avec ces commandes sous sudo. Cat est une commande UNIX qui signifie <concatenate>, en gros, ça permet d'ajouter des valeurs à un fichier de configuration ou à fusionner le contenu de plusieurs fichiers. On s'en sert (trop) souvent pour afficher le contenu d'un fichier.
Il faut mieux l'utiliser en simple utilisateur :

$ cat /etc/mkinitcpio.conf
# vim:set ft=sh
# MODULES
# The following modules are loaded before any boot hooks are
# run.  Advanced users may wish to specify all system modules
# in this array.  For instance:
#     MODULES=(usbhid xhci_hcd)
MODULES=()

# BINARIES
# This setting includes any additional binaries a given user may
# wish into the CPIO image.  This is run last, so it may be used to
# override the actual binaries included by a given hook
# BINARIES are dependency parsed, so you may safely ignore libraries
BINARIES=()

# FILES
# This setting is similar to BINARIES above, however, files are added
# as-is and are not parsed in any way.  This is useful for config files.
FILES=()

# HOOKS
# This is the most important setting in this file.  The HOOKS control the
# modules and scripts added to the image, and what happens at boot time.
# Order is important, and it is recommended that you do not change the
# order in which HOOKS are added.  Run 'mkinitcpio -H <hook name>' for
# help on a given hook.
# 'base' is _required_ unless you know precisely what you are doing.
# 'udev' is _required_ in order to automatically load modules
# 'filesystems' is _required_ unless you specify your fs modules in MODULES
# Examples:
##   This setup specifies all modules in the MODULES setting above.
##   No RAID, lvm2, or encrypted root is needed.
#    HOOKS=(base)
#
##   This setup will autodetect all modules for your system and should
##   work as a sane default
#    HOOKS=(base udev autodetect modconf block filesystems fsck)
#
##   This setup will generate a 'full' image which supports most systems.
##   No autodetection is done.
#    HOOKS=(base udev modconf block filesystems fsck)
#
##   This setup assembles a mdadm array with an encrypted root file system.
##   Note: See 'mkinitcpio -H mdadm_udev' for more information on RAID devices.
#    HOOKS=(base udev modconf keyboard keymap consolefont block mdadm_udev encrypt filesystems fsck)
#
##   This setup loads an lvm2 volume group.
#    HOOKS=(base udev modconf block lvm2 filesystems fsck)
#
##   This will create a systemd based initramfs which loads an encrypted root filesystem.
#    HOOKS=(base systemd autodetect modconf kms keyboard sd-vconsole sd-encrypt block filesystems fsck)
#
##   NOTE: If you have /usr on a separate partition, you MUST include the
#    usr and fsck hooks.
HOOKS=(base udev autodetect microcode modconf kms keyboard keymap consolefont block filesystems fsck)

# COMPRESSION
# Use this to compress the initramfs image. By default, gzip compression
# is used. Use 'cat' to create an uncompressed image.
#COMPRESSION="gzip"
#COMPRESSION="bzip2"
#COMPRESSION="lzma"
#COMPRESSION="xz"
#COMPRESSION="lzop"
#COMPRESSION="lz4"
#COMPRESSION="zstd"

# COMPRESSION_OPTIONS
# Additional options for the compressor
#COMPRESSION_OPTIONS=()

# MODULES_DECOMPRESS
# Decompress kernel modules during initramfs creation.
# Enable to speedup boot process, disable to save RAM
# during early userspace. Switch (yes/no).
#MODULES_DECOMPRESS="yes"
Là, on ne risque pas de casser quoique ce soit, puisqu'on ne peut qu'afficher le contenu.
Par contre, certains fichiers ne peuvent être affichés pour un simple utilisateur. Exemple :

$ cat /etc/sudoers.d/10-installer
cat: /etc/sudoers.d/10-installer: Permission non accordée
Là, bien sûr, il faudra les droits administrateur.
Répondre